登录  /  注册
首页 > Java > java教程 > 正文
使用java的String.concat()函数连接两个字符串
PHPz
发布: 2023-07-26 13:09:38
原创
166人浏览过

Java是一种面向对象的编程语言,提供了许多字符串操作的方法。其中一个常用的方法是使用String类的concat()函数来连接两个字符串。本文将介绍concat()函数的使用方法,并提供一些示例代码。

首先,让我们来了解一下concat()函数的功能。concat()函数用于将两个字符串连接在一起,返回一个新的字符串。它的调用方式为在第一个字符串上调用concat()函数,并传入第二个字符串作为参数。下面是一个简单的示例:

String str1 = "Hello";
String str2 = "World";
String result = str1.concat(str2);
System.out.println(result);  // 输出 "HelloWorld"
登录后复制

在这个示例中,我们首先定义了两个字符串str1和str2,分别为"Hello"和"World"。然后,我们调用str1对象的concat()函数,并将str2作为参数传入。concat()函数会将str2连接到str1后面,返回一个新的字符串"HelloWorld"。最后,我们通过使用System.out.println()函数将结果打印出来。

除了使用点操作符调用concat()函数之外,我们还可以使用加号(+)进行字符串的连接。例如:

String str1 = "Hello";
String str2 = "World";
String result = str1 + str2;
System.out.println(result);  // 输出 "HelloWorld"
登录后复制

这个示例和上一个示例的结果是完全相同的。使用加号进行字符串的连接在实际开发中更为常见。

另外,concat()函数也可以用于连接多个字符串。只需要对多个字符串依次进行concat()操作即可。例如:

String str1 = "Hello";
String str2 = " ";
String str3 = "World";
String result = str1.concat(str2).concat(str3);
System.out.println(result);  // 输出 "Hello World"
登录后复制

在这个示例中,我们定义了三个字符串str1、str2和str3,分别为"Hello"、空格和"World"。然后,我们使用连续的concat()函数操作将它们连接在一起。注意,我们先将str1和str2连接在一起,得到一个新的字符串"Hello ",然后再将这个字符串与str3连接起来,得到最终的结果"Hello World"。

除了使用concat()函数之外,Java中还提供了许多其他的字符串操作方法。比如,我们可以使用startsWith()函数来判断一个字符串是否以指定的前缀开始;使用endsWith()函数判断一个字符串是否以指定的后缀结尾;使用substring()函数来截取字符串的一部分等等。

总结一下,Java中的String类的concat()函数可以用于连接两个字符串,它接受一个字符串作为参数,并返回一个新的字符串。通过使用concat()函数,我们可以在开发中更方便地进行字符串的连接。当然,在实际开发中,我们也可以使用加号(+)进行字符串的连接,这更为常见。无论是使用concat()函数还是加号进行字符串连接,都可以根据实际需求来选择合适的方法。

希望本文能对使用String类的concat()函数连接两个字符串这个主题有所帮助。在实际开发过程中,请根据项目要求和个人喜好来选择适合的字符串连接方式。祝大家编程顺利!

以上就是使用java的String.concat()函数连接两个字符串的详细内容,更多请关注php中文网其它相关文章!

相关标签:
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 技术文章
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2023 //m.sbmmt.com/ All Rights Reserved | 苏州跃动光标网络科技有限公司 | 苏ICP备2020058653号-1

 | 本站CDN由 数掘科技 提供

登录PHP中文网,和优秀的人一起学习!
全站2000+教程免费学